Ceiling Leak Repair Service in Denver County, CO
Ceiling leak repair services address issues caused by water intrusion that results in damage or staining to ceiling surfaces. These projects typically involve locating the source of the leak, which may originate from plumbing fixtures, roof damage, or HVAC systems, and then repairing or replacing affected materials to prevent further water damage. Homeowners often seek this service when noticing water spots, sagging ceilings, or mold growth, and they want to understand the scope of repairs needed, potential causes, and the importance of timely action to avoid structural issues or additional damage.

Identifying Ceiling Leaks
Signs of ceiling leaks include water stains, sagging drywall, and peeling paint in denver county homes.
Common Causes Of Ceiling Leaks
Leaks often result from roof damage, plumbing issues, or poor sealing around vents and fixtures.
Repair And Prevention Tips
Proper sealing, timely repairs, and regular inspections help prevent future ceiling leaks in properties across denver county.

Ceiling Leak Repair Service Questions
What causes ceiling leaks? Ceiling leaks are often caused by roof damage, plumbing issues, or HVAC system failures that allow water to seep into the ceiling area.
How can I tell if my ceiling has a leak? Signs include water stains, discoloration, sagging drywall, or peeling paint on the ceiling surface.
Is it necessary to repair the ceiling after a leak? Yes, repairing the ceiling helps prevent further damage, mold growth, and structural issues caused by water exposure.
What types of ceiling materials are suitable for repairs? Common materials include drywall, plaster, and drop ceiling tiles, depending on the existing ceiling type and extent of damage.
